Speaker 0:Where we've really enjoyed the success is I call it the sweet spot, but it's that point that month before the state assessments are given where we're able to have very intentional reviews.
Speaker 0:We're very focused on our pacing and we don't like to be teaching new content right up until the state assessment day. We like to finish our content earlier so that we can spend some time in that sweet spot reviewing, and we have really capitalized on the use of the American Book Company books and those courses to be able to help us as we're doing that spiral review at that time.
